47555 Biliary endoscopy thru skin
Also known as: Percutaneous cholangioscopic stricture dilation, POCS dilation
Percutaneous endoscopy of the biliary tree with stricture dilation using balloon or other technique to open narrowed segments of the bile ducts.
Clinical Context
Performed for benign and malignant biliary strictures under direct visualization. Allows accurate identification and treatment of stenosis.
RVU Breakdown
| Work RVU | 7.36 |
| Practice Expense RVU | 0.68 |
| Malpractice RVU | 0.96 |
| Total RVU | 9.00 |
